The Global Missions and Outreach Ministry is the arm of the Historic Ebenezer Baptist Church that takes the message and mission of justice across the globe. We are committed to building relationships through intentional service and the ministry of presence. Guided by the principles of faith, justice, and love, we serve as a bridge of hope, bringing transformation to communities near and far. Together, we strive to embody the teachings of Jesus Christ and the legacy of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. through acts of service and compassion. Local Work

Community Fairs: Held on the first Saturday of every month, we provide essential supplies and services to our unhoused neighbors.

Food Justice Initiatives: Through our Crisis Closet and partnerships, we address food insecurity in Atlanta.

Global Work

London Missions Trip (2024): A transformative experience for over 150 members of our church.

Ethiopia Water Sanitation Project: Partnering with Beza Tabernacle Church to bring clean water to over 2,000 children and families in the Oromo region.
